Did I get bent? You decide.
I may get something wrong on names, but these are the facts.
I dove one week on the Charisma with Pam as Captain. We were in a kelp bed at Santa Barbara Island on the morning of the second day. Parked near us was the Encore with (I think) her husband as skipper. Apparently he decided to go free diving... so some wags on our boat decided to throw eggs at him. Well, they couldn't make it the distance. I decided to give it a toss and was able to bracket him nicely, but it was at my limit of range. They all appreciated my efforts greatly.
I did know that the long range egg lobbing gave my arm a twinge. Nothing to think about... then.
Next weekend I was on the Peace to Nic and we did an amazing early morning dive to 125 feet to look for bugs. The vis was so good that the bugs I saw, saw me from so far away that they just backed into their holes when I was still 25 feet away. The amazing part about the dive was I found a creek or what was a creek in another geological time. It was a fascinating thing to see on any dive.
Anyway, I surfaced as normal. Who knows what the times were? I don't pay that close attention, but I had a distinct jag in my arm where I had pulled it the weekend before. Localized bad circulation??
Hmmmm mmmm. I didn't particularly deny it, but neither did I concern myself.
I did my next dive with particular attention to the ascent. My arm felt fine.Was that a local bend???
Actually, I am obviously not disposed to DCS, cuz otherwise I would have gotten it sometime after all those dives with my double 90's at the badlands.
